Transaction 0617d176ff905131bc3ca48a409bc692669bd69ac037d77a0767ce022d526d8c
1 Input
1 Output
-
0617d176ff905131bc3ca48a409bc692669bd69ac037d77a0767ce022d526d8c:0
- value
- 16509594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d31292f33fa26516c8a47e800e56325475e1e742 OP_EQUAL
- address
- 3Lw4kZmbTQWndt7JnukGjipk8K48LyWpW3